Description:
At John Paul Construction we believe every project is an opportunity to improve on what’s gone before. To foster that mindset, we hire the brightest and best in the industry, encourage a collaborative approach, and embrace innovative thinking and new technology.

Due to continued expansion we require a Junior Electrical Engineer for a role based in Shankill, South Dublin on a new residential project.

Key responsibilities

1. Assisting with the implementation of the MEP deliverables on the project

2. Work collaboratively with the project, design team and subcontractors

3. Assisting M&E staff in all work relating to the safe and timely completion of projects

4. Working with the team to Inspect all installation works against the agreed level of the approved quality plan

5. Attend project meetings

Specific Requirements

1. Relevant Third level qualification in Building Services M&E (Electrical) .

2. 6 Months – 2 years’ experience in electrical enegineering.

3. Previous Main Contractor experience is preferred, ideally projects experience preferable.

4. Excellent IT skills – knowledge of Revit/BIM, Microsoft.

Package
As a permanent John Paul Construction employee, you can benefit from:
Competitive Salary, Company Laptop, Company phone, Pension, Life insurance, Income Protection, Continuous Professional Development (CPD), Access to Lifestyle Benefits (such as, Bike to work scheme, Employee Assistance Programme, Sports & Social Club) and many more.
We fully embrace the right of all employees to work in an environment that ensures equal opportunity and treatment with dignity and respect
